Job summary

Advocate Health Care in Chicago, IL seeks a staff sonographer to perform diagnostic ultrasound exams and ensure quality imaging. The role emphasizes patient advocacy, education before/during/after exams, and collaboration with physicians and departments.

Requirements include ARDMS registration, CPR certification, and 1–2 years of experience. You will participate in CQI, adhere to safety standards, and contribute to departmental goals in a fast-paced hospital environment.

Quality
  • Accountable for the production of quality sonograms .
  • Demonstrates the appropriate operation of all sonography equipment including transducers, doppler energy package, laser printers, telaradiography etc.
  • Demonstrates safety in all areas, electrical and environmental.
  • Ensures all appropriate information is present before sonograms are performed, including verification of physician orders.
  • Completes all data entries in the radiology and hospital system.
  • Participates in efforts to monitor and improve departmental CQI indicators.
  • Submits ideas for improving quality in your department.

Physical Requirements And Working Conditions

May be exposed to life threatening diseases.

Ability to adjust hours with minimal notice as required.

Ability to stand for long periods of time.

Ability to view small crt screens.

Ability to work odd hours.

Ability to respond to emergency call.

Ability to lift and/or move patients.

Ability to work under stressful conditions

Ability to work rotating shifts any day of the week.

Ability to stand, bend and /or stoop for extended periods of time.

If position has direct patient care or direct patient contact the following lifting requirement supersedes any previous lifting requirement effective 06/01/2015.

Ability to lift up to 35 pounds without assistance. For patient lifts of over 35 pounds, or when patient is unable to assist with the lift, patient handling equipment is expected to be used, with at least one other associate, when available.
